Associate Professor, Discipline Leader-Finance

Dr. Rahul Sharma holds Master of Commerce in Accounts & Law and Doctor of Philosophy degree in Accounts and Law (Commerce) from Dr. Bhim Rao Ambedkar University (Formerly Agra University), India. He did his B. Com. (Hons.) from Dayalbagh Educational Institute, (Deemed University), India. 
He has about 17 years of work experience in educational institutes as an educator, researcher and academic administrator. He has teaching and research experience at management institutions of repute in India and UAE. 
Dr. Rahul has published research papers in reputed refereed international journals and guided four scholars for doctoral research work. His teaching and research interest areas include financial inclusion, mergers and acquisition. Financial statement analysis, entrepreneurship and Corporate Finance.
